本文作者:访客

区块链DAG是什么意思?区块链DAG有什么优势?

区块链DAG,全称为有向无环图,是一种新型的数据结构,近年来在区块链技术领域备受关注,它与传统的区块链结构相比,具有一定的优势,被认为是未来区块链技术发展的重要方向,下面将从DAG的概念、优势等方面进行详细介绍。

DAG的概念

有向无环图(DAG)是一种图形数据结构,由顶点(节点)以及连接这些顶点的有向边组成,在DAG中,不存在任何的闭环,即从一个顶点出发,无法通过一系列的边回到该顶点,这种结构具有很好的数学性质,使得DAG在许多领域得到了广泛的应用,如计算机科学、人工智能、数据库等。

在区块链领域,DAG被用来表示交易之间的依赖关系,每个交易都可以看作一个顶点,而交易之间的依赖关系则通过有向边来表示,通过这种方式,DAG能够有效地组织交易数据,提高区块链系统的性能。

区块链DAG的优势

1、高效的交易处理能力

与传统的区块链结构相比,DAG能够实现更高的交易处理能力,在比特币等区块链系统中,交易需要被打包进区块,然后由矿工进行挖矿确认,这个过程导致了交易处理的瓶颈,尤其是在网络拥堵的情况下,而DAG通过去除区块的概念,采用一种更加灵活的数据结构,使得交易可以并行处理,从而提高了交易处理速度。

2、更低的交易确认时间

在DAG中,交易确认时间可以得到显著降低,由于交易之间不存在严格的依赖关系,因此在DAG中,只要交易所需的依赖交易被确认,该交易即可被确认,这有助于减少交易在网络中的传播时间,提高整个系统的效率。

3、抗审查性

DAG结构的抗审查性主要体现在两个方面:一是由于其去中心化的特点,攻击者难以对整个网络进行控制;二是DAG中的交易具有匿名性,使得审查者难以追踪交易的实际发起者,这些特点使得DAG在保护用户隐私方面具有优势。

4、节能环保

在传统的区块链系统中,挖矿过程需要消耗大量能源,而DAG结构取消了挖矿机制,采用一种共识算法来确认交易,这种算法不需要大量的计算资源,从而降低了能源消耗,有利于环保。

区块链DAG是什么意思?区块链DAG有什么优势?

5、可扩展性

DAG具有良好的可扩展性,能够适应不断增长的网络规模,随着网络中节点的增加,DAG可以有效地扩展,从而提高整个系统的性能。

区块链DAG的应用前景

区块链DAG技术在未来有望在以下领域得到广泛应用:

1、金融领域:利用DAG的高效交易处理能力,可以构建一个低延迟、高并发的金融交易系统。

2、供应链管理:DAG可以有效地组织供应链中的各个环节,提高供应链的透明度和效率。

3、身份认证与数据隐私保护:DAG的匿名性和抗审查性使其在身份认证和数据隐私保护方面具有潜力。

4、物联网:DAG结构可以用于组织物联网设备之间的通信,提高物联网系统的安全性和可靠性。

区块链DAG作为一种新型的数据结构,具有许多优势,有望在未来的区块链技术发展中发挥重要作用,DAG技术仍处于研究阶段,需要进一步解决诸如安全性、可扩展性等问题,才能在实际应用中发挥其潜力,在未来的探索中,我们期待DAG能为区块链技术带来更多突破性的进展。

阅读
分享